What is Welding

Welding joins two metal parts by heating, applying pressure, or both — creating an atomic-level bond at the joint. Unlike bolted connections (removable), welding produces a permanent joint whose strength can approach or exceed the base metal.

Three main categories: Fusion welding (melting), Pressure welding (pressure), and Brazing (filler metal below base metal melting point).
